FREQUENCY HOPPING SOUNDER SIGNAL FOR CHANNEL MAPPING AND EQUALIZER INITIALIZATION
First Claim
1. A method comprising:
- identifying a frequency range for sounding a communication path between a first device at a first location within a wellbore and a second device at a second location within the wellbore;
generating a sounding signal having a non-contiguous frequency with the second device byassigning a center frequency, a bandwidth, and a timeframe to each of a plurality of sounding sequences, such that an entirety of the frequency range is assigned to the plurality of sounding sequences, andplaying the plurality of sounding sequences in order according to the timeframe assigned to each sounding sequence in the plurality of sounding sequences;
transmitting the sounding signal through the communication path to produce an attenuated sounding signal;
receiving, at the first device, the attenuated sounding signal;
comparing the attenuated sounding signal to the sounding signal, to yield a comparison; and
estimating a transfer function of the communication path based on the comparison.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for channel sounding and initializing an equalizer using a frequency hopping sounder signal. The system identifies a frequency range for sounding a channel between a first device at a first location within a wellbore and a second device at a second location within the wellbore. Center frequencies, bandwidths, and timeframes are assigned to each of a plurality of sounding sequences, such that an entirety of the frequency range is assigned to the plurality of sounding sequences, and wherein when played in order according to the timeframe assigned to each sounding sequence in the plurality of sounding sequences, a sounding signal having a non-contiguous frequency is produced. By comparing an attenuated sounding signal based on the sounding signal to the sounding signal, the system estimates a transfer function of the channel. The system also initializes the equalizer based on the comparison.
26 Citations
20 Claims
-
1. A method comprising:
-
identifying a frequency range for sounding a communication path between a first device at a first location within a wellbore and a second device at a second location within the wellbore; generating a sounding signal having a non-contiguous frequency with the second device by assigning a center frequency, a bandwidth, and a timeframe to each of a plurality of sounding sequences, such that an entirety of the frequency range is assigned to the plurality of sounding sequences, and playing the plurality of sounding sequences in order according to the timeframe assigned to each sounding sequence in the plurality of sounding sequences; transmitting the sounding signal through the communication path to produce an attenuated sounding signal; receiving, at the first device, the attenuated sounding signal; comparing the attenuated sounding signal to the sounding signal, to yield a comparison; and estimating a transfer function of the communication path based on the comparison.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system comprising:
-
a processor; and a computer-readable storage medium having instructions stored which, when executed by the processor, cause the processor to perform operations comprising; identifying a frequency range for sounding a communication path between a first device at a first location within a wellbore and a second device at a second location within the wellbore; generating a sounding signal having a non-contiguous frequency with the second device by assigning a center frequency, a bandwidth, and a timeframe to each of a plurality of sounding sequences, such that an entirety of the frequency range is assigned to the plurality of sounding sequences, and playing the plurality of sounding sequences in order according to the timeframe assigned to each sounding sequence in the plurality of sounding sequences; transmitting the sounding signal through the communication path to produce an attenuated sounding signal; receiving, at the first device, the attenuated sounding signal; comparing the attenuated sounding signal to the sounding signal, to yield a comparison; and estimating a transfer function of the communication path based on the comparison.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A computer-readable storage device having instructions stored which, when executed by a computing device, cause the computing device to perform operations comprising:
-
identifying a frequency range for sounding a communication path between a first device at a first location within a wellbore and a second device at a second location within the wellbore; generating a sounding signal having a non-contiguous frequency with the second device by assigning a center frequency, a bandwidth, and a timeframe to each of a plurality of sounding sequences, such that an entirety of the frequency range is assigned to the plurality of sounding sequences, and playing the plurality of sounding sequences in order according to the timeframe assigned to each sounding sequence in the plurality of sounding sequences; transmitting the sounding signal through the communication path to produce an attenuated sounding signal; receiving, at the first device, the attenuated sounding signal; comparing the attenuated sounding signal to the sounding signal, to yield a comparison; and estimating a transfer function of the communication path based on the comparison.
-
Specification